Output d1784fb98b7f7274551f249122287c2ac4add619a98512a5b80a76806d50131e:77

value
584770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ae4111c4daf420bf86de3509e09c55c6be1b1d8 OP_EQUAL
address
3CtoaJs11MbWnuqffL1NyyjonMwHsvpMVC
transaction
d1784fb98b7f7274551f249122287c2ac4add619a98512a5b80a76806d50131e
spent
true